Robot Using Raspberry Pi & Bridge Shield (1 / 6 paso)

Paso 1: Paso 1: configuración de frambuesa Pi con software básico

Lista de ingredientes:

  1. Escudo de puente o junta L293D
  2. Un Pi de frambuesa (con SD tarjeta y sistema para la configuración inicial de energía)
  3. Módulo USB de la cámara de la cámara/Pi
  4. Chasis robot con pinzas motor, pernos de tuerca y periféricos.
  5. Dos motores de BO
  6. Batería de Ion de litio (2 células, aproximadamente 1000-2000mAh)
  7. Arduino UNO (opcional)
  8. ESP8266 el módulo de wifi (opcional)
  9. 1,3 pulgadas OLED (opcional)

En primer lugar, usted necesitará configurar un servidor Web en su frambuesa Pi, junto con PHP. Te recomiendo leer este instructable

En este punto asumo que usted ha seguido los anteriores instructable y conocer los conceptos básicos de arrancar un Pi, instalar el sistema operativo, conexión del pi a un teclado + ratón + monitor o habilitar el modo SSH para acceder a la IP de forma remota y permitiendo a la cámara de pi.

Una vez hecho lo anterior vamos a comenzar con la instalación de Apache. Apache es una herramienta de creación y gestión de servidor web completo. Puede realizar enérgicamente diversas funciones por eso es muy popular.

Ahora vuelta al trabajo, arranque su pi abrir la terminal (o una conexión SSH) y escriba este comando en el símbolo del sistema

$sudo apt-get update

Usted verá un montón de instrucciones en la pantalla. Déjelo todo el extremo (usted sabrá cuando llegue el "$" con luz intermitente rápida).

A continuación instalamos apache y PHP usando el siguiente comando en el terminal mismo

$sudo apt-get instala apache2 php5 libapache2-mod-php5

Le preguntará si desea instalar los paquetes con la siguiente frase que aparece: "desea continuar", tipo "y" golpe volver y entrar.

Espere a que la instalación completar (esto puede tomar un tiempo y sabrás su hecho cuando vea la luz intermitente rápida con sólo el '$').

Si ahora inicie un navegador web en su computadora y escriba la dirección IP de tu IP en la barra de direcciones, verá un mensaje que dice algo como"su sitio de Internet trabajo/marcha!".

Opcionalmente también se puede instalar a un servidor ftp con los siguientes comandos

$sudo apt-get install vsftpd

Ahora que ha instalado al servidor FTP necesita hacer un poco de configuración. Ver instrucciones a continuación:

$sudo nano /etc/vsftpd.conf

(nano es un editor de texto incorporado en el OS Raspbian. Ayuda para editar o modificar los archivos desde el terminal rápidamente)

Desplazarse por el archivo y cambiar las siguientes líneas:

anonymous_enable = YES cambiar a anonymous_enable = NO

Y eliminar el "#" (sin comentarios) para las siguientes dos líneas

#local_enable = YES cambiar a local_enable = YES

#write_enable = YES cambiar a write_enable = YES

Al final del archivo agregue la siguiente línea de código:

force_dot_files = sí

Para guardar y salir exitosa "Ctrl + x", luego pulsa "y", luego el retorno (Enter).

Ahora usted tendrá que reiniciar el servidor FTP para que los cambios para que surtan efecto, utilice el siguiente comando:

$sudo service vsftpd restart

Artículos Relacionados

Arduino I2C

Arduino I2C

I2C (cuadrado C) es un protocolo maestro / esclavo serial, implica la comunicación entre 2 o más Arduinos con uno Arduino como master y el otro como esclavo. Este proceso también puede utilizarse para ampliar el número de puertos si desea hacer un pr
Controlando un Robot con un mando de Wii

Controlando un Robot con un mando de Wii

Esto es un pequeño proyecto que utiliza un Raspberry Pi, un Robot de Pinzón y un mando de Wii (también conocido como Wiimote), para mostrar algunas de las cosas que puedes hacer con una frambuesa pi o un Wii remote. Utiliza Python y la biblioteca de
Carro RC a Arduino Robot con sensores múltiples

Carro RC a Arduino Robot con sensores múltiples

este instructable abarca la conversión de un carro RC en un robot controlado por Arduino. Mi intención al iniciar este proyecto fue A) aprender más sobre Arduino y programación B) construir una plataforma confiable de bajo costo para ampliar C) gasta
Robot barato con Arduino

Robot barato con Arduino

quería aprender electrónica, Arduino, programación, y de soldadura lo pensé me elige uno de los proyectos de Randy y copiarlo.Terminé con una configuración de motor diferente. Mi motor parte delantera apunta hacia abajo y vuelve un poco equipo de bar
Frambuesa de Pi de Robot controlado por Bluetooth

Frambuesa de Pi de Robot controlado por Bluetooth

este tutorial se basa en un Instructable anterior -Robustezas del edificio con Raspberry Pi y PythonEl objetivo es presentar un ejemplo de cómo configurar una conexión Bluetooth en serie con Arduino para controlar un robot de Raspberry Pi. Pero permi
Dar tu Robot frambuesa Pi un cerebro de gusano

Dar tu Robot frambuesa Pi un cerebro de gusano

El gusano Elegans de C es uno de los animales más estudiados en la ciencia. En Neurobiología, es el modelo más básico del cerebro los científicos usan para estudiar cómo funciona el cerebro. Ahora usted puede tener un robot que piensa como uno!El cer
Controlar su Robot usando teléfono celular

Controlar su Robot usando teléfono celular

Este TUTORIAL completo también está disponible en mi sitio webHola mundo en este post me mostrará usted cómo controlar robot con teléfono móvil. Controlar un robot mediante teléfono móvil no es tan complicado como tu forma de pensar es muy sencilla q
Dos servo robot controlado por TI launchpad de caminar

Dos servo robot controlado por TI launchpad de caminar

http://blog.Vinu.co.in/2012/06/Two-servo-walking-robot-Using-ti.html
Robots cuadrúpedos con 2 servos de arduino casero

Robots cuadrúpedos con 2 servos de arduino casero

bueno cada unoSi tenes un arduino mini y dos servos estándar que usted puede hacer un poco robo a pie en dos 4 patas del animal doméstico.pero en el proyecto no utiliza un arduino original. He utilizado un microcontrolador ATmega8 con cargador de arr
Twitter con texto a voz

Twitter con texto a voz

Que el mundo sabe lo que está comiendo el desayuno con un sintetizador vocal del estilo de los años 80! Este proyecto utiliza un Arduino para enviar el stream de Twitter a un chip generador de voz llamado el SpeakJet. La configuración que utilizo aqu
Selector de Color de LED RGB

Selector de Color de LED RGB

uno de los desafíos de trabajar con LEDs RGB está haciendo la derecha valores rojo, verde y azul para que coincida con un color que está intentando mostrar.  Puede iniciar con los colores de la web y luego a veces necesitará ajustar ya que los LEDs n
Un conectados a Facebook, música de fiesta de Arduino-Powered

Un conectados a Facebook, música de fiesta de Arduino-Powered

música de fiesta es una nueva forma de escuchar música con los demás. Golpeando un dispositivo RFID/NFC que está sincronizado con una cuenta de Facebook en un lector de RFID de Arduino shield y envío que ID único servidor de música de fiesta utilizan
Nike reponer luz

Nike reponer luz

Me dieron la tarea de crear un objeto que utiliza un Arduino Uno. A partir de ahí he desarrollado la idea de crear un estado de ánimo pequeña luz que responde a una frase que se escribió en Twitter que por cuenta de Twitter específica. El propósito d
Aplicación del código

Aplicación del código

se trata de la unidad de ejecución de código. cosas que tienen código mostrará el código, y los pájaros se un chirrido y cantar nuestras alabanzas. va a ser una letanía de gran éxito, con bardos para llevar en las mareas del tiempoPaso 1: Porciones d